Output 0521372cbb9fab5e59448b6d4190228507f77757d7034278510f69abe4848193:135

value
75283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c64d5ec7e50677bc25ee9c7a4d03cf2e4ce5af58 OP_EQUAL
address
3KmYQJchcQmdqp6U3sJXb16s16VSK6ikTi
transaction
0521372cbb9fab5e59448b6d4190228507f77757d7034278510f69abe4848193
spent
true